Job description

Job Summary

The Infrastructure Services Engineering Manager is a proven leader responsible for nurturing, developing, and supporting a team of engineers working across customer engagements. Reporting to a Senior Manager, this role focuses on career growth, productivity, and overall success of engineering talent rather than direct project execution. The manager ensures engineers are equipped with the right tools, knowledge, and guidance to excel, while fostering a collaborative, inclusive, and high‑performing team culture.

Responsibilities
  • Lead, mentor, and support a diverse team of infrastructure engineers (full‑time and contractors)
  • Drive career development, coaching, and continuous learning for direct reports
  • Manage staffing, utilization, and capacity planning across professional services engagements
  • Act as an escalation point for engineering‑related customer issues
  • Collaborate with peer managers to achieve practice and organizational goals
  • Ensure adherence to delivery methodologies, standards, and best practices
  • Conduct performance evaluations and provide constructive feedback
  • Build and maintain relationships with subcontractors and external partners
  • Evaluate and improve engineering processes to enhance quality, efficiency, and profitability
  • Promote a culture of collaboration, inclusion, and continuous improvement
Qualifications
  • Proven experience in engineering leadership or people management roles, managing diverse teams across multiple projects or service lines
  • Strong technical background across infrastructure domains, including networking (routing, switching, SD‑WAN), unified communications (UC, UCCE, VoIP), wireless (WiFi), data center, security, and end‑user computing (EUC)
  • Hands‑on experience with cloud platforms such as AWS and/or Azure, along with exposure to automation tools and frameworks
  • Solid understanding of professional services delivery models and customer engagement practices
  • Ability to effectively balance people management responsibilities with technical oversight
  • Excellent interpersonal and conflict resolution skills with the ability to manage diverse teams
  • Strong mentoring and coaching mindset with a focus on career development and employee growth
  • Effective communication and stakeholder management skills across all organizational levels
  • Demonstrated ability to build inclusive, collaborative, and high‑performing teams
  • Strong organizational, planning, and decision‑making capabilities
